R. Kelly's Ex-Employee Tells Grand Jury There Are More Child Sex Tapes ... Claims Feds Have Them

Published | Updated

A former employee of R. Kelly told a grand jury the singer regularly recorded tapes of his sexual encounters with underage girls and kept them as trophies ... and they're now believed to be in the hands of the feds.

Sources directly connected to the case tell TMZ ... the ex-employee testified in front of a federal grand jury in the Northern District of Illinois Thursday, and claims to have been in possession of multiple tapes in which the singer engages in sex acts with minors.

We're told the former employee told grand jurors R. Kelly paid a large sum of cash to the employee and in return, the employee handed a tape over to the singer. We're told somehow the tape in question ended up in the hands of Cook County State's Attorney Kim Foxx.

Our sources say the ex-employee testified they gave the feds several other child sex tapes featuring Kelly.

We're told the former employee said R. Kelly's crew knew full well Kelly had a penchant for having sex with underage girls, but rather than blow the whistle on him, they actually helped the singer procure young girls.

R. Kelly's attorney, Steve Greenberg, tells TMZ, "This seems to be the same claims that were made in the state case. We will address them in court."

A spokesperson for the U.S. Attorney for the Northern District of Illinois declined to comment.

As we've told you ... the federal grand jury in IL has heard testimony from alleged victims who say the singer and his camp transported them across state lines for sex when they were underage.

There are also 2 other federal probes into Kelly in New York's Eastern and Southern Districts, and of course ... he's still facing multiple counts of sex abuse and sexual assault in Cook County.

'L&HH' Star Tommie Lee Escapes Hard Time in Child Abuse Case ... With One MAJOR Caveat

Published

Tommie Lee might want to send her judge a Christmas card this year, because despite facing up to 54 years ... she won't spend a day in prison, IF she stays out of trouble ... for the next decade.

The 'Love & Hip Hop' star was sentenced Friday in her child abuse case after pleading guilty to 5 charges -- including first-degree cruelty to children. The judge gave her 10 years, but none of them will be served in prison. Instead, Tommie's been ordered to complete a residential recovery program and 12 months of successful aftercare with licensed doctors.

If she does that, she'll remain on probation for the rest of the sentence -- that's the good news for her. The difficult part is ... that's a long time to keep her nose clean, and any slipup could mean immediate prison time.

Under her probation conditions, Tommie can't have violent contact with a child, can't travel outside the state of Georgia without written approval and can't attend work or promo events where drugs or alcohol are present. That part could make 'L&HH' shoots difficult.

She'll also have an 11 PM curfew, pay a $1,000 fine and submit to random drug and alcohol testing. We're told she's already out of custody and in the recovery program.

We broke the story ... Lee requested entry into the court's mental health program following her arrest and indictment on child abuse charges for assaulting her middle school-aged daughter. A judge denied her, but it seems Tommie's going to get help after all.

Now, she's just gotta stay out of trouble ... for a long time.

Jenelle Evans & David Eason Lose Custody of Their 3 Kids ... At Least For Now

Published | Updated

Jenelle Evans and David Eason suffered a major court defeat Tuesday, when a judge ruled they will not regain custody of their 3 children ... and they will have virtually no face-to-face contact for the time being.

After 4 days of explosive testimony, in which Jenelle, David, Kaiser's dad Nathan Griffith and others testified about problems in the home, the judge decided there were serious issues with Jenelle and David that put the children at risk.

The trigger for the hearing was David killing the family dog earlier this month. As we reported, Child Protective Services ordered 4-year-old Kaiser to stay with Nathan, 9-year-old Jace with his grandma, Barbara, and 2-year-old Ensley also with Barbara.

Sources connected to the case tell TMZ, for the time being, Jenelle and David can see their kids only once a week for an hour with supervision.

As one source put it, "It's all David's fault."

Another source says the judge laid out a number of steps Jenelle and David must take in order to regain custody, including parenting classes, counseling and weekly drug testing.

And yet, another source told us Kaiser was "extremely fearful" of going back to the family house and claimed he was mistreated by David. His concerns were brought up in court and we're told affected the judge's decision.

As for Jenelle, one source says she was "stunned" by the ruling and believed she would walk out of court Tuesday with her kids. Instead, she walked out with David.

'Maleficent' Producer Joe Roth Files for Divorce

Published | Updated

Joe Roth, one of the most prolific producers in Hollywood who's producing the upcoming "Maleficent," has filed for divorce ... TMZ has learned.

Joe, whose credits include "Snow White and the Huntsman," "Oz the Great and Powerful," Charlie Sheen's "Anger Management," "Heavy Weights" and "The Forgotten," filed Friday and his wife, Irene, filed her response at the same time.

Joe, the former Chairman of Walt Disney Studios, and Irene are both requesting joint custody of their 2 kids, a boy and a girl.

There's a lot of money on the line. Joe is the majority owner of the Seattle Sounders major league soccer team along with billionaire Paul Allen.

Based on the docs, it has all the signs the divorce has already been mediated. The address of the law firm is that of disso queen Laura Wasser, whose M.O. is to mediate and then file both a petition and response at the same time.

According to the docs, the issue of spousal support has not been resolved, however, based on what appears to be a full mediation, it seems like the book is closed on all financial issues.

Joe and Irene married in 2006.
